[PATCH 3/3] clk: samsung: Use cached clk_hws instead of __clk_lookup() calls

From: Sylwester Nawrocki <s.nawrocki@samsung.com>
Date: 2020-08-26 17:16:23
Also in: linux-clk, linux-devicetree, linux-samsung-soc, lkml
Subsystem: common clk framework, samsung soc clock drivers, the rest · Maintainers: Michael Turquette, Stephen Boyd, Krzysztof Kozlowski, Sylwester Nawrocki, Chanwoo Choi, Peter Griffin, Linus Torvalds

For the CPU clock registration two parent clocks are required, these
are now being passed as struct clk_hw pointers, rather than by the
global scope names. That allows us to avoid  __clk_lookup() calls
and simplifies a bit the CPU clock registration function.
While at it drop unneeded extern keyword in the function declaration.

diff --git a/drivers/clk/samsung/clk-cpu.c b/drivers/clk/samsung/clk-cpu.c
index efc4fa6..00ef4d1 100644
--- a/drivers/clk/samsung/clk-cpu.c
+++ b/drivers/clk/samsung/clk-cpu.c
@@ -401,26 +401,34 @@ static int exynos5433_cpuclk_notifier_cb(struct notifier_block *nb,
 
 /* helper function to register a CPU clock */
 int __init exynos_register_cpu_clock(struct samsung_clk_provider *ctx,
-		unsigned int lookup_id, const char *name, const char *parent,
-		const char *alt_parent, unsigned long offset,
-		const struct exynos_cpuclk_cfg_data *cfg,
+		unsigned int lookup_id, const char *name,
+		const struct clk_hw *parent, const struct clk_hw *alt_parent,
+		unsigned long offset, const struct exynos_cpuclk_cfg_data *cfg,
 		unsigned long num_cfgs, unsigned long flags)
 {
 	struct exynos_cpuclk *cpuclk;
 	struct clk_init_data init;
-	struct clk *parent_clk;
+	const char *parent_name;
 	int ret = 0;
 
+	if (IS_ERR(parent) || IS_ERR(alt_parent)) {
+		pr_err("%s: invalid parent clock(s)\n", __func__);
+		return -EINVAL;
+	}
+
 	cpuclk = kzalloc(sizeof(*cpuclk), GFP_KERNEL);
 	if (!cpuclk)
 		return -ENOMEM;
 
+	parent_name = clk_hw_get_name(parent);
+
 	init.name = name;
 	init.flags = CLK_SET_RATE_PARENT;
-	init.parent_names = &parent;
+	init.parent_names = &parent_name;
 	init.num_parents = 1;
 	init.ops = &exynos_cpuclk_clk_ops;
 
+	cpuclk->alt_parent = alt_parent;
 	cpuclk->hw.init = &init;
 	cpuclk->ctrl_base = ctx->reg_base + offset;
 	cpuclk->lock = &ctx->lock;
@@ -430,23 +438,8 @@ int __init exynos_register_cpu_clock(struct samsung_clk_provider *ctx,
 	else
 		cpuclk->clk_nb.notifier_call = exynos_cpuclk_notifier_cb;
 
-	cpuclk->alt_parent = __clk_get_hw(__clk_lookup(alt_parent));
-	if (!cpuclk->alt_parent) {
-		pr_err("%s: could not lookup alternate parent %s\n",
-				__func__, alt_parent);
-		ret = -EINVAL;
-		goto free_cpuclk;
-	}
-
-	parent_clk = __clk_lookup(parent);
-	if (!parent_clk) {
-		pr_err("%s: could not lookup parent clock %s\n",
-				__func__, parent);
-		ret = -EINVAL;
-		goto free_cpuclk;
-	}
 
-	ret = clk_notifier_register(parent_clk, &cpuclk->clk_nb);
+	ret = clk_notifier_register(parent->clk, &cpuclk->clk_nb);
 	if (ret) {
 		pr_err("%s: failed to register clock notifier for %s\n",
 				__func__, name);
@@ -471,7 +464,7 @@ int __init exynos_register_cpu_clock(struct samsung_clk_provider *ctx,
 free_cpuclk_data:
 	kfree(cpuclk->cfg);
 unregister_clk_nb:
-	clk_notifier_unregister(parent_clk, &cpuclk->clk_nb);
+	clk_notifier_unregister(parent->clk, &cpuclk->clk_nb);
 free_cpuclk:
 	kfree(cpuclk);
 	return ret;
